1、 Blade difference
The leaves of Phyllostachys pubescens are lanceolate, about 4-8 cm long and about 1 cm wide. The top is acute and sharp, the base gradually narrows, connate into a sheath, and the edge is entire
The shape of carnation leaves is linear lanceolate, which is narrower than the former, about 3-5cm long and 2-4mm wide. The top is acuminate, the base is slightly narrowed, and the whole edge or has small teeth
2、 The difference between flowers
The number of flowers of Dianthus pubescens is large, with a head like inflorescence and several leafy involucral bracts. The bracts are oval, the petals have long claws, and the petals are oval, usually red purple and white stripes
The inflorescence is 4-flower-like, or the flower is aggregated in the shape of an umbrella. Its petals are inverted egg shaped triangles with various colors, such as purplish red, bright red, pink or white
